Podcasting is a wild and amazing journey. One minute you're excitedly recording your latest episode, and the next you're drowning in editing and second-guessing every little detail. In this episode, we dive into the seven telltale signs that you might just be taking your podcasting journey a smidge too seriously...because taking your podcast too seriously is possible.We chat about how obsessing over minor editing mistakes can suck the joy out of your creative process. I mean, have you ever listened to a popular podcast that sounded like it was recorded underwater? Probably Yet, they still have tens of thousands of listeners. This just goes to show that your audience is more interested in the content that you can give them rather than a perfectly polished audio track. So, are you finding yourself giving up fun for perfection? If you're stressing over a missed breath sound or an awkward pause, it might be time to reevaluate your approach.In the episode, we also tackle the pressure of posting schedules. Yes, consistency is key, but if that pressure is making you want to pull your hair out, it's time to hit the brakes. Remember, podcasting should be a joy, not a chore. And comparing yourself to full-time creators with fancy studios? Let's just say it's a recipe for burnout. We're all just trying to make magic happen from our dining tables, right? Plus, we discuss the dangers of over-planning. If you find yourself exhausted before even hitting record, that's a sign you might be overthinking it. Let's embrace spontaneity and authenticity instead.Whether you're podcasting as a hobby or a business strategy, it's crucial to keep the fun alive. So, if you've ever wondered, ‘should I quit my podcast?', or are wondering how to re-inject the fun back into your podcast, this episode is for you.Takeaways: Taking your podcast too seriously can drain the joy out of creating, so keep it light and enjoy the creative process. If you find yourself obsessing over every tiny editing mistake, it's time to relax a bit. No-one is going to mind about the odd breath or 0.2 second pause. Remember, podcasting can be a fun hobby, not just a business strategy or stress-inducing chore. Comparing yourself to full-time creators may lead to burnout, so embrace your unique journey and what your individuality can bring to your show. Over-planning your episodes can kill spontaneity. Keep it real and authentic for you and your audience. You can have liver damage for decades without any signs of liver failure. Spotting these 7 early signs of liver disease could save your life. Find out about the signs your liver is dying so you can act before it's too late.0:00 Introduction: 7 signs your liver is dying0:32 The real cause of liver damage 1:14 7 liver dying symptoms3:05 Right shoulder pain4:06 Itchy skin and liver disease 5:16 Swollen abdomen and liver problems6:57 Reversing liver damage 8:22 How to improve liver health quickly Your liver is the hardest-working organ in your body, and the only major organ that can completely regenerate.Here are 7 liver warning signs that may indicate liver damage before the issue becomes too severe.1. Waking up between 2 and 3 a.m. A dysfunctional liver causes excessive blood sugar swings at night. A steep drop in blood sugar while you're sleeping spikes adrenaline, which will wake you up.2. Right shoulder painWhen the liver is damaged, bile production slows down, leading to sluggish and clogged bile ducts. This can cause referred pain in the right shoulder. 3. Bruise easilyThe liver makes clotting factors, so if it's damaged, you may find that you bruise more easily. 4. ItchingItching at night, particularly on the bottom of the feet and other parts of the body, can be caused by excess bile that backs up in the liver. 5. Low tolerance to alcoholPeople with liver problems can not efficiently break down alcohol, which causes more toxicity in the body.6. Fat belly/skinny legs A protruding belly is usually caused by an advanced form of liver damage called ascites, where fluid begins to build up in the abdomen. This is often associated with legs that are skinny due to muscle loss. 7. Brain irritationWhen the liver is damaged, you can't effectively break down protein, which causes a backup of ammonia. This affects cognitive function and personality, leading to irritability, temper issues, brain fog, and difficulty focusing.You can go from a severely damaged liver to a healthy liver within weeks by avoiding hidden sugars in your diet!Try these 7 tips to improve liver health and reverse liver damage:1. Stop snacking2. Eliminate sugar, starch, and seed oils 3. Eat more high-quality meat and vegetables4. Go to sleep earlier5. Choose organic foods6. Consume cruciferous vegetables7. Can you be lean and metabolically unfit? Can you be overweight and metabolically healthy? Most of the world's type 2 diabetics are lean. Weight is not the issue. It's a distraction from what actually matters: metabolic fitness. Dr. Betty Murray sits down with Dr. Beverly Yates ND to shatter the myths about metabolic health, weight, and diabetes, especially for women over 40. In this conversation, Dr. Yates reveals the silent signs of pre-diabetes most doctors miss, why the "eat less, exercise more" advice fails women after menopause, and the five steps of the Yates Protocol that helped women reverse type 2 diabetes after 25+ years, without deprivation or restriction. What We Cover: ● Weight is not the issue, it's a symptom: Most type 2 diabetics worldwide are lean (not overweight), you can be lean and metabolically unfit OR overweight and metabolically healthy, doctors blame weight instead of looking at actual metabolic markers ● The silent signs of pre-diabetes ● Objective markers that actually matter: Hemoglobin A1C, fasting blood sugar, fasting insulin, C-peptide ● Why BMI is useless ● Menopause changes everything metabolically: Loss of estrogen = increased visceral fat + insulin resistance (even with same diet/exercise), women have more microvascular disease than men, hot flashes linked to hyperdensities in brain (vascular damage) ● Why lean people don't get diagnosed: Doctors assume "you're skinny, you're fine" without checking A1C/fasting insulin/C-peptide, visceral fat can be invisible (not always "beer belly"), third of teenagers now have pre-diabetes ● The taste bud reset: Taste buds turn over every 10-14 days, they talk to brain about calories, diet sodas/artificial sweeteners trick brain → causes snacking 1-1.5 hours later PLUS, The 5 Steps of the Yates Protocol: (1) Nutrition, (2) Meal timing, (3) Stress management, (4) Sleep, (5) Exercise with emphasis on strength training.
